Electoral (District Boundaries) Amendment Bill
Government bill
2 March 2026
This bill amends the Electoral Act 1993 to align the policy settings in the Act with the Government's work to modernise the census process, while ensuring that there is a logical link between boundary reviews and the electoral cycles to which they relate.
- Introduced on 2 March 2026
- 1st reading on 5 March 2026
